any one notice VZW and Sprint LCDS are not the same?

Has anyone noticed that the sprints touch pro and touch pro 2's LCD screen always looks sharper and more vibrant? it's true. try flashing the same rom and put them next to each other im not sure if VZW is using a different lcd or lower amps to power the backlit to save battery, but it's not the same.

I agree. Sprint's LCD is much more vibrant and VZW seems to have a yellowish tone to it when next to a sprint TP but VZW's screen is WAY more scratch resistant, I guess that's why it does not come with a screen protector. I love the VZW screen, you press on the sprint one in the right light and you see it warp, the VZW is solid and feels so much better on the fingers...
